So… Tissue Salt or 30C+?
This is where it can get confusing, because Kali Phos is one of the 12 tissue salts (cell salts) and a homeopathic remedy (available in higher potencies). Both remedies are made from the same substance, but are used differently:
Tissue Salt Kali Phos 6x
• Think daily support during times of worry, study, or strain.
• Gentle and restorative, like feeding your nervous system.
• Ideal when symptoms are mild, low-level, or long-standing.
• Especially good for kids, carers, students, or anyone run-down.
Tissue Salts can be taken 2–4 times daily over weeks or months.
If you’re still needing the tissue salt daily after 3+ months, it might be time to try a higher potency or get support from a homeopath for a more tailored prescription.

Kali Phos 30C or 200C
• Reaches deeper when the nervous system seems to have crashed.
• Good after long phases of worry, grief, illness, sleep loss, injury, intensive studying or researching or prolonged burnout.
• Energy is intense or erratic.
Dosage idea: Use 2–3 times per week for a few weeks, or seek guidance from a homeopath
